Fifth Inning Rally Lifts West Central Baseball to Win

The West Central high school baseball team used a fifth-inning rally to help them to an 8-4 win over McCook Central on Wednesday, May 7th.

McCook Central started with a 1-0 lead by scoring a run in the bottom of the first.  West Central tied the game with a run in the top of the third.  They took the lead, 2-1, with a run in the top of the fourth.  The big blow was delivered by West Central when they scored five runs for a 7-1 lead.  McCook Central scored a run in the bottom of the fifth.  Both teams scored a run in the sixth making the score 8-3 in favor of West Central.  McCook Central scored one more run in the bottom of the seventh.

Keaton Vessells had two hits, one a home run, with two RBIs.  Caden Alfson had a home run with three RBIs.  Gunnar Alfson added two hits.  Beckett Everson, Zach Lorang, and Lando Whiting all had one hit each.  Hayes Cain added an RBI.  Ashton Gebhardt pitched 5 2/3 innings and allowed three earned runs on seven hits and two walks with six strikeouts.  CJ DenBoer pitched 1 1/3 innings and allowed an earned run on three hits with two strikeouts.
